The place Medieval Historical past Comes Alive
York is not simply outdated – it is historical outdated. Based by the Romans after they referred to as it Eboracum (strive saying that 3 times quick), this place has seen every little thing from Viking invasions to medieval prosperity. As I wandered by town, I could not assist however really feel like I used to be strolling by a dwelling historical past e-book.


Emperor Constantine the Nice was topped right here in AD 306 – informal, proper? Town later thrived as a medieval buying and selling hub due to its worthwhile wool commerce. This wealth explains all of the jaw-dropping structure you may see round each nook. Medieval retailers weren’t precisely refined about displaying off their cash, and thank goodness for that!

The Shambles: OMG IT’S ACTUALLY DIAGON ALLEY
Absolutely the spotlight of my first day was wandering down The Shambles. Guys. GUYS. This road is actually Diagon Alley come to life. The medieval timber-framed buildings lean inward a lot that they virtually contact on the prime, creating this magical tunnel-like feeling as you stroll by.


It is extensively believed J.Ok. Rowling took inspiration from The Shambles when creating Diagon Alley, and strolling by, it is not possible to not see why. The road dates again to the 14th century and was initially crammed with butcher outlets (the title “Shambles” truly comes from the Anglo-Saxon phrase for slaughterhouse – the extra you realize!).

Clifford’s Tower: A Tragic Historical past With Epic Views


I virtually missed Clifford’s Tower, which might have been a significant oversight! This stone tower sits atop a grassy mound and is just about all that is still of York Fortress. The historical past right here is intense – in 1190, it was the location of one of many worst anti-Jewish massacres of medieval England when about 150 Jewish folks took refuge within the tower and plenty of selected suicide over being captured by the mob beneath. Fairly sobering.


Regardless of its tragic previous, climbing to the highest provides a number of the finest panoramic views of York. The latest renovation has added a roof deck and inside walkways that make exploring a lot simpler. Getting Round York
York is extremely walkable. Town middle is compact, and most sights are inside a 15-minute stroll of one another. Actually, strolling can be one of the best ways to find these charming hidden corners and snickelways that do not make it into the guidebooks.
In case your toes get drained (mine actually did after a day on these cobblestones), there are many buses serving town. Taxis are additionally available, although they can not entry a number of the pedestrianized areas within the very middle.
For a enjoyable various, hire a motorcycle! York is sort of cycle-friendly, with devoted paths alongside the river and across the metropolis partitions.
